What Makes This Hot Chocolate So Creamy

The secret lies in the combination of milk, cream, and real chocolate. As everything melts slowly, the cocoa solids fully dissolve, creating a smooth, luxurious drink. Sweetened condensed milk adds richness and sweetness while helping thicken the mixture.

This balance creates hot chocolate that’s indulgent without being overly sweet.

Crockpot Hot Chocolate

Rich and creamy slow cooker hot chocolate made with real chocolate and milk, perfect for serving a crowd.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 2 hours
Total Time 2 hours 5 minutes
Servings: 8 cups
Course: Dessert, Drink
Cuisine: American
Calories: 320

Ingredients
  

  • 4 cups milk
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 14 oz sweetened condensed milk
  • 2 cups semi-sweet chocolate chips
  • 0.25 cup cocoa powder
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 0.25 tsp salt

Equipment

  • Slow cooker
  • Whisk

Method
 

  1. Add all ingredients to a slow cooker and stir to combine.
  2. Cover and cook on low for 2 hours, stirring occasionally, until smooth.
  3. Whisk gently to ensure a creamy consistency.
  4. Switch to warm setting and serve with toppings.

Notes

Stir occasionally to prevent chocolate from settling.

Best Chocolate to Use

Semi-sweet chocolate chips offer the perfect balance of sweetness and cocoa flavor. You can also use chopped chocolate bars for a deeper, richer taste.

Avoid chocolate with waxy coatings, which won’t melt smoothly.

Tips for Perfect Crockpot Hot Chocolate

  • Stir every 30 minutes for even melting
  • Keep lid on to retain heat
  • Switch to “warm” once melted
  • Add milk if it thickens too much

Fun Variations

  • Peppermint hot chocolate with extract
  • Dark chocolate version using bittersweet chocolate
  • White hot chocolate with white chocolate chips
  • Spiced hot chocolate with cinnamon

Make-Ahead and Storage

  • Can be made a few hours ahead and kept warm
  • Refrigerate leftovers up to 3 days
  • Reheat gently in crockpot or stovetop
